CHICAGO – Following the success of Cowan's + Clark + DelVecchio's June 4, 2011 ceramics sale, we are pleased to announce our third ceramics auction to take
place the weekend of November 4-5, 2011. The two day sale will be held at [3]Hotel 71 in Chicago. The event features pieces from well-known ceramics and craft artists from around the world. The sale is divided into two sections. The first section, held on November 4, features Legends: Material Masters, and will be limited to 50 masterworks post-1945. Highlights in the sale include a
Kenneth Price Geomtric Cup, and a stack pot by Peter Voulkos titled Siguirilla. The second section, on November 5, is titled Modern Ceramic Art and
Design and will consist of primarily studio ceramics from such artists as Lucie Rie, Wayne Higby, and Rick Dillingham.
A Kenneth Price Geometric Cup (image above) is estimated to bring anywhere between $100,000/150,000. A well known American ceramic artist, Kenneth Price
studied ceramics under Peter Voulkos. Price is best known for his abstract shapes constructed from fired clay. The cup has been a fascination for Price
since he began making functional pottery in Los Angeles in the early 1950's, eventually joining Voulkos at the Otis Art Institute in 1957. Price's series "Geometric Cups", to which this work belongs, was created in Taos, New Mexico between 1972 and 1973 and is considered to be on the top rung of this artist's oeuvre.
"The most sought after of Ken Price's works are his geomtric cups and none have come to the auction market for several years. We are very excited to be
offering this one in our November 4 auction".
-Garth Clark
A Stack Pot by Peter Voulkos titled Siguirilla, 1999, is estimated to bring $70,000/120,000. Voulkos' Stoneware Stack Pot titled Gash set a world record in Cowan's + Clark + DelVecchio's November 6, 2010 sale, selling for $105,575. Peter Voulkos' work is found in museums around the world, including the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Museum of Modern Art, and the Philadelphia
Museum of Art.
